“Only 4 stars because of the long wait ( 1hr outside, about 2 inside just waiting) but know that I did not have an appointment. Staff was extremely knowledgeable, helpful AND friendly! (Though tired, they're dealing with a lot).
1. Make sure your documents are COMPLETELY filled out BEFORE coming. If not I guess do it in line outside but bring a clipboard or something to write on. They do have a LIMITED supply of paper applications and they run out so that's why they recommend coming with your own.
2. Be prepared to wait. Bring water, headphones, a portable charger for your phone, a book, playing cards, whatever. You're gonna have to kill some time. There is AC inside and god bless them a fan (and it's hot) but there's an outside area with tables should you brave the heat (some of them have umbrellas so it's not too bad). One lady brought lunch with her. Queen.
3. Be prepared to STAND too. There aren't enough chairs. Wear comfortable shoes.
4. There are NO public bathrooms.
5. There are vending machines that are cash/coin only. Not sure if it's expensive but at least those are an option.
6. There was a fruit vendor near here and that fruit looked glorious in this heat so BRING CASH and support your local vendor.
All in all, my partners appointment only took him like 5 mins lol. Other people's seem to take way longer.”
